Nestled in the serene locality of Hayathnagar, near Hyderabad, the Hayat Bakshi Begum Masjid stands as a testament to the architectural brilliance and cultural legacy of the Qutb Shahi dynasty. Built in 1672 during the reign of Abdullah Qutb Shah, the mosque was dedicated to the revered Hayat Bakshi Begum, a prominent and influential figure in the Qutb Shahi court. This mosque, known for its grandeur and intricate design, reflects the opulence and devotion of its era. Architectural Splendor The mosque is a masterpiece of Qutb Shahi architecture, combining Islamic and Persian design elements. Its majestic fa?ade features symmetrical arches adorned with intricate stucco patterns. The minarets, with their ornate carvings, stand as sentinels of time, symbolizing strength and faith. The interiors of the mosque are equally captivating, with elegant prayer halls, beautifully inscribed Quranic verses, and a serene courtyard offering a tranquil space for worshippers. The white domes, standing tall against the azure sky, exude an aura of divine grace. Adjacent to the mosque lies a stepwell that once served as a vital water source for the local community, showcasing the thoughtful planning and sustainability practices of the Qutb Shahi rulers. Historical Significance The Hayat Bakshi Masjid is not just a place of worship but also a symbol of Hyderabad's rich cultural and political history. Hayat Bakshi Begum, affectionately known as "Ma Saheba" (Revered Mother), played a pivotal role in the administration of the Qutb Shahi kingdom. Her contributions to the kingdom's welfare, education, and architecture are immortalized in this grand mosque. In May 2009, the mosque drew attention when the Archaeology and Museums Department sought to protect its heritage by requesting the removal of illegal structures surrounding it. This move highlighted its importance as a preserved monument under the Ancient Monuments and Archaeological Sites and Remains Act of 1960.
